Surface preparation and adhesion
The adhesion of a glue is directly linked to surface preparation. Thorough degreasing and, if necessary, light sanding are essential to ensure a durable bond. The choice of adhesion primer, compatible with the materials to be assembled, is also a determining factor.
- Surface degreaser cleaner: Essential for removing oils, greases, and other contaminants.
- Adhesion promoter for plastics: Improves adhesion on difficult plastics, such as polypropylene.
- Fine-grit sandpaper: To create a bonding surface without damaging materials.
- Preparation wipes: Convenient for quick and effective cleaning.
Marine-specific glues and sealants
The marine environment imposes specific constraints: humidity, temperature variations, vibrations, UV exposure. The selected glues and sealants must withstand these aggressions to ensure a durable and watertight assembly. The choice will depend on the materials to be assembled (metal, plastic, wood, etc.) and the mechanical stresses.
- Sikaflex 291i: Multi-purpose polyurethane sealant, ideal for sealing and flexible bonding.
- Loctite 406: Cyanoacrylate adhesive for rapid bonding of small components, especially in electronics.
- Neutral silicone sealant: For sealing hull fittings and other components passing through the hull.
- Two-component epoxy: For structural bonding requiring high mechanical strength.
Sealing and protection of connections
The watertightness of electrical connections is crucial to prevent corrosion problems and short circuits. Specific solutions exist to protect connectors and cables from saltwater ingress. The use of sealing resins or heat-shrink tubing with integrated adhesive is recommended.
- Sealing resin for connections: Effectively protects electrical connections against moisture.
- Heat-shrink tubing with adhesive: Ensures perfect sealing of cables and connectors.
- Dielectric silicone grease: Protects electrical contacts from corrosion.
- Self-amalgamating tape: For sealing cables and emergency repairs.
